Sachin Tendulkar to launch anti-drug, liquor campaign in Kerala

THIRUVANANTHAPURAM: Legendary cricketer Sachin Tendulkar will kick off the Vimukthi Mission's awareness campaign against liquor and substance abuse here on November 20. Excise minister T. P. Ramakrishnan told the Assembly on Monday that Mr Tendulkar has agreed to attend the launch of awareness campaign under Vimukthi. "Tendulkar had earlier consented to be the brand ambassador of the state's anti-liquor and anti-drug awareness initiatives. The state would be making effective utilisation of his service," said the minister. He was replying to a calling attention motion of CPI's C. Divakaran.

The state government last month decided to form the mission to initiate anti-liquor and anti-drug campaigns, replacing the previous administration's Subodham. It was as part of the LDF's policy of promoting liquor abstinence rather than going for prohibition. Mr Ramakrishnan said that the objective of Vimukthi was to eliminate the use of alcohol and substances through awareness programmes in association with Student Police Cadets, NCC and other voluntary organisations.
